Holi, the festival of colors, is one of the most celebrated festivals in India and around the world. It marks the arrival of spring and the victory of good over evil. Traditionally, Holi is played with vibrant colors, but in recent years, chemical-based colors have raised concerns due to their harmful effects on health and the environment. In this guide, we’ll explore how to celebrate Holi safely with natural and eco-friendly alternatives.

FAQs
1. How can I remove natural colors easily?
Natural colors are easy to wash off with mild soap and warm water. Applying coconut oil beforehand makes removal even easier.
2. Where can I buy organic Holi colors?
Many online and offline stores now sell organic Holi colors. Check for certified brands that ensure chemical-free ingredients.
3. Are homemade colors safe for kids?
Yes, DIY natural colors are completely safe for children as they are made from edible and non-toxic ingredients.
4. Can I use essential oils in homemade colors?
Yes, adding a few drops of essential oils like lavender or sandalwood enhances fragrance and provides skin benefits.
5. How can I reduce water wastage during Holi?
Opt for dry Holi with natural powders, and if using water, do so minimally and responsibly.
